Signature Dishes
Let's start with the tamales, which are a must-try. These delectable parcels are made from masa (corn dough) and filled with a variety of ingredients, from tender meats to fresh vegetables. The tamales at Deli El Chapincito are steamed to perfection, resulting in a soft and flavorful bite that transports you straight to the streets of Guatemala. Pair them with their homemade salsas for an extra kick—just be prepared, some patrons have requested spicier options, so be sure to ask!

Next up are the pupusas, another staple that truly shines in this establishment. These stuffed corn tortillas are filled with savory ingredients like cheese, beans, or pork, and served hot off the griddle. Each bite is a burst of flavor, and the crispy exterior paired with the gooey filling creates a delightful texture that keeps you coming back for more. Don't forget to ask for the accompanying curtido, a tangy slaw that adds a refreshing contrast.
And let’s not forget the carnitas. The slow-cooked pork is seasoned to perfection, tender and juicy, making it a favorite among regulars. Served with tortillas, you can build your own tacos, loaded with all your favorite toppings. The generous portions ensure that you'll leave satisfied, and the vibrant flavors will have you dreaming about your next visit.
Drinks
To wash it all down, you can’t miss out on the traditional beverages offered at Deli El Chapincito. Their horchata, a sweet rice milk drink with cinnamon, is the perfect complement to your meal, providing a refreshing contrast to the savory dishes. If you’re in the mood for something more tangy, try the tamarindo, a unique drink made from tamarind fruit that is both sweet and sour. These drinks not only quench your thirst but also enhance the overall dining experience, bringing you closer to Guatemalan traditions.

Location & Accessibility
Located at 168 Lexington Avenue, Deli El Chapincito is nestled in a bustling area of New York that is easily accessible from various parts of the city. Whether you’re coming from Manhattan or the outer boroughs, this destination is well-connected by public transport, making it a convenient stop for anyone in search of genuine Guatemalan flavors. However, parking can be quite limited, and nearby lots may charge fees, so it’s advisable to plan ahead, especially during peak hours. Price & Value
One of the best aspects of Deli El Chapincito is its affordability. Most dishes range from $5 to $15, making it a budget-friendly option for diners looking to enjoy a hearty meal without breaking the bank. The generous portions ensure that you get good value for your money, and the authentic flavors make every bite worth it.
